STREET IMPROVEMENTS.


In no previous year since Oakland was settled, were there such exten- sive and expensive street improvements made as in the year 1877. The amount of grading, macadamizing, sewering, sidewalking, and curbing done has immeasurably improved the condition and appearance of the thoroughfares of the city.


Not less than $320,285.33 have been expended by the City Council for street improvements during the past year. The most notable contracts were the following:


Grading and macadamizing of Sixteenth Street, from Franklin to Oak, $7,181.44.


Grading, curbing, and macadamizing of Jefferson Street, from First to Sixteenth, $12,967.08.


Grading and macadamizing of Broadway from Prospect Place to char- ter line, $18,321.90.


Grading and macadamizing of Willow Street, from Peralta to Bay Street, $7,716.48.


Grading and macadamizing of Campbell Street, from Third to Fifteenth Street, $11,976.81.


Grading and macadamizing of Seventh Street, from Oak to Franklin Street, $8,246.26.


Grading and macadamizing of Taylor Street, from Cedar to Peralta. $5,787.55.


Grading and macadamizing of Tenth Street, from Centre to Adeline, $6,089.82.


Curbing and macadamizing of Thirteenth Avenue, from East Sixteenth Street to East Twenty-second Street, $5,741.24.


Macadamizing of Seventh Avenue, from Ninth to Eighteenth Street, $6,710.53.


Grading, curbing, and macadamizing of West Street, from Ninth to Eighteenth Street, $6,382.34.


Grading and macadamizing of Lincoln Street, from Peralta to the bay, $5,728.51.


Grading and macadamizing of Seventeenth Street, from Grove to Market Street, $5,721.13.


Macadamizing of Ninth Avenue, from Tenth to Eleventh Street, $4,962.26.


Sewering of Market Street, from Fourteenth to Twenty-second Street, $4,06.00.


Grading and macadamizing of Twelfth Avenue, from San Antonio Creek to East Seventeenth Street, $5,066.05.


Grading and macadamizing of Ninth Avenue, from East Seventeenth to East Tenth Street, $5,088.02.


Macadamizing of East Sixteenth Street, from Ninth Avenue to Thir- teenth Avenue, $4,193.87.


.


Grading and curbing and macadamizing of Second Street, from Madi- son to Jefferson, $8,750.


Repairs at Twelfth Street Bridge, $3,940.


The system of sewerage is being gradually improved and extended, and the City Council seems determined to promptly remedy all existing defects.


The completion of the Lake Merritt sewer has been of the greatest importance in a sanitary point of view, and now the extensive tract lying between that body of water and the west shore of the bay is regarded as among the most healthful in the whole city.
